Manchester United youngster D'Mani Mellor suffers serious knee injury

straight to your inboxManchester United youngster D'Mani Mellor revealed he has suffered an ACL injury and is facing a lengthy spell on the sidelines. The 19-year-old made 14 appearances for the Under-23s this season, scoring four goals and notching six assists, and was handed his senior United debut in the 2-1 defeat by Astana in the Europa League last year.

Everything we know so far about Greater Manchester's new lockdown restrictions

People from different households in Greater Manchester, parts of east Lancashire and West Yorkshire have been banned from meeting each other inside their homes or in gardens following a spike in virus cases.The new rules also ban members of two different households from mixing in pubs, restaurants and other hospitality venues, but these businesses will remain open for those visiting individually or from the same household.The Government said it will give police forces and councils powers to
